During building and construction, a confirmatory examination for dirt compaction is done on-site to guarantee that no future settlement occurs
After the concrete is put -7 days and 28 days- tests are conducted on concrete samples gathered from the site to make sure that the concrete put meets the layout requirement. Asphalt core is taken after the Asphalt is laid and compacted to verify that it meets the style criterion. All lab examination records are analysed by the Geotechnical Designer to make sure that it meets the project spec.

Nonetheless, rates of pay usually boost as your understanding and abilities grow, with guidelines indicating a graduate beginning income of in between 18,000 and 28,000 per year in the UK. This increases to 26,000 to 36,000 with a few years of experience and after that getting to 40,000 to 60,000+ for senior, chartered or master engineers.

These operations allow specialists to evaluate a host of soil technicians including weight, porosity, void-to-solid particle proportion, permeability, compressibility, maximum shear stamina, birthing ability and deformations. If the framework calls for a deep foundation, designers will certainly use a cone infiltration examination to approximate the amount of skin and end bearing resistance in why not find out more the subsurface.
When evaluating an incline's balance of shear tension and shear stamina, or its ability to endure and undertake activity, rotational slides and translational slides are generally considered. Rotational slides fail along a rounded surface, with translational slides happening on a planar surface area. A specialist's objective is to identify the conditions at which a slope failing can happen.
Commonly, searchings for recommend that a website's dirt should be treated to enhance its shear stamina, rigidity and permeability before layout and building.
